뜻
Used when being introduced to someone.
문화적 배경
Czechs often shake hands firmly when saying 'Těší mě'. The phrase is used identically in Slovakia. In business, it is common to add the person's title. It is considered polite to wait for the older person to initiate a handshake.
Keep it simple
You don't need to add anything to 'Těší mě'. It is perfect on its own.
Eye contact
Always look the person in the eye when saying it to show sincerity.
